Aims and Scope
**********************
In Human-centric Computing and Information Sciences (HCIS), KIPS-CSWRG publishes high quality papers which cover the various theories and practical applications related to human-centric computing and information sciences. The published papers present results of significant value to solve the various problems with application services and other problems which are within the scope of HCIS. In addition, we expect they will trigger further related research and technological improvements relevant to our future lives.

**********************
Topics
**********************
Human-centric Computing and Information Sciences stands for the continuously evolving and converging information technologies, including:
· Human-computer interaction and Multimodal
· Internet of Things and Sensors
· Cloud, Edge and Fog computing
· Social computing and Intelligence
· Computer-assisted Learning and Cognition
· Block-chain and data mining
· Privacy, Security and Cryptography
· AI and Big data analytics for HCIS
· Ambient Intelligence
· Cyber-physical systems and Smart devices cc
· Mobile computing and wireless communications
· Smart city - applications and services
· HCIS services, applications, and implementations
